Summary

In this chapter, we've discussed everything parameter expansion in Bash. We started by recapping how we've used parameter substitution throughout most of this book, and how parameter substitution is only a small part of Bash parameter expansion.

We moved on to show you how we can use parameter expansion to include default values for variables, in case the user does not supply their own. This functionality also allows us to present the user with an error message if input is missing, although not in the cleanest way.
